What is the role of ATP synthase in photonthesis?

ATP synthase plays a crucial role in photosynthesis by synthesizing ATP, the primary energy currency of the cell. During the light-dependent reactions, it uses the proton gradient generated by the electron transport chain in the thylakoid membrane of chloroplasts to drive the phosphorylation of ADP to ATP. This ATP is then utilized in the Calvin cycle to convert carbon dioxide into glucose and other organic compounds. Thus, ATP synthase is essential for energy production in the process of photosynthesis.

What is the role of ATP synthase in the Krebs cycle?

ATP synthase is not directly involved in the Krebs cycle. However, it plays a crucial role in oxidative phosphorylation, which occurs after the Krebs cycle in cellular respiration. ATP synthase generates ATP by utilizing the energy released during the flow of protons through the inner mitochondrial membrane.

At synthase in the chloroplast membrane makes atp utilizing the energy of highly concentrated?

ATP synthase in the chloroplast membrane synthesizes ATP by harnessing the energy from a proton gradient created during the light-dependent reactions of photosynthesis. As protons flow back into the stroma through the ATP synthase enzyme, this movement drives the conversion of ADP and inorganic phosphate (Pi) into ATP. The process is a crucial part of the overall energy transformation in photosynthesis, enabling the plant to store energy in a usable form.
